Today November 5, sad news for Ubuntu users has arrived. One of the official Ubuntu flavors will stop developing as directed by the development team. We refer to mythbuntu, the official flavor that is destined for the multimedia world and above all for MythTV.
The official flavor I was using Ubuntu and Xfce as a base to build this official flavor, but it makes versions that arrive late or do not release a version as in this latest release. For this reason, the team may have decided to discontinue the distribution and stop supporting it.
But this does not mean that MythTV is no longer on Ubuntu, far from it. While mythbuntu-desktop will disappear from Ubuntu repositories, other packages will be kept and A PPA repository has been enabled so that users can install MythTV on top of Xubuntu, thus the result will be similar to Mythbuntu but saving efforts.
Mythbuntu will follow through a repository and MythTV
To have the latest version of Ubuntu and MythTV we only have to add the mentioned repositories to Xubuntu 16.10. At least that's how it is stated in the official statement issued by the Mythbuntu team.
